Dec 30, 2011ip tunneling with persistency while reply must not pass thourgh f5
three member of a pool are mapped with a virtual server.
Client will initiate persistence connection with F5.
f5 generate a connection with Physical server.
But Physical server need to reply the Client without passing through F5.
Will it be possible by any mean.
I need to expose the physical server ip to the client.
So that clinet can use this IP to update information on another Server.
